摘要
凤-同区间是广州市轨道交通二、八号线延长线关键控制工程之一,采用矿山法施工。地质条件十分复杂,周边沿线桥梁密布,需要采用桩基托换。古建筑林立,严重影响施工进度和作业安全。文章从工程地质、设计及施工角度对其重难点进行了梳理,研究成果可为工程提供技术支持,也可为类似工程提供参考。
